I trust that you are having a good week.  This week has been a blessing to Guyla and me.  We have seen some answers to prayer.  That is always a blessing.  God’s word states:  ”Ask and ye shall receive, that your joy may be full.”  (John 16:24)   That is true.  There is no joy  in life like the joy of having seen God answer a prayer.  How essential it is that we pray.  Our Prayer tells God that we have recognized that our dependence on Him is absolutely essential.  By praying we have admitted to God the truth we find in John 15:5 where we read:  ”I (Jesus Christ is the Speaker) am the Vine, ye are the branches:  he that abideth in Me, and I in Him, the same bringeth forth much fruit: for without Me ye ca do nothing.”  
Scriptural prayer involves the realization that I can do nothing for the Lord except by His presence and power.  May we each realize that wonderful truth this week.
